Understanding the Fundamentals of European Wheel of Fortune as a Career Path
If you’ve ever been captivated by the spinning wheel and the thrill of the wagers placed in European roulette, you might consider exploring it as a career path.
European wheel of fortune offers an exciting blend of strategy and luck, making it appealing for those seeking to make a living in gaming houses. Understanding the game’s regulations and probabilities is crucial; the unique zero slot lowers the casino advantage compared to American wheel of fortune, giving you an edge.
You’ll also need to cultivate robust critical analysis abilities to evaluate risks and trends. Establishing relationships with players improves the engagement, as does perfecting financial control.
Whether you’re a croupier or a player in competitions, European roulette can provide an thrilling career filled with opportunities and obstacles.
